Adeko 14.1
Request
Download
link when available

Install cors. Why is CORS important? Currently, clie...

Install cors. Why is CORS important? Currently, client-side scripts (e. Learn how to enable CORS headers in your web application with this simple step-by-step guide. This allows Ktor to respond correctly to a CORS preflight request. 【初心者向け】CORSとは何か?仕組みと解決方法をやさしく解説! Webアプリを開発していると、APIにアクセスしたときに 「CORSエラー」が出て困った経験、ありませんか? この記事では、CORS(Cross-Origin Resource Sharing)の基本から、 The command npm install cors — save is used here to install the package and automatically save it to the dependencies section of the package. If you must manually install extensions, you can do so by using Azure Functions Core Tools locally. With end-to-end type safety and great developer experience. The extension optionally uses the "chrome. js application, you will need to install it with npm, npm install cors. CORS Cheat Sheet for Express + TypeScript. conf), or within a . This is useful because complex applications often reference third-party APIs and resources in their client-side code. Security Implications Forces use of wildcard * origin (insecure) Cannot support credentials properly Cannot scope CORS to specific paths In the world of web development, CORS (Cross-Origin Resource Sharing) is an essential concept that Tagged with node, beginners, learning. Un agent utilisateur réalise une requête HTTP multi-origine (cross A Django App that adds Cross-Origin Resource Sharing (CORS) headers to responses. This guide shows how to install and use the cors module in Node. Non-browser clients (curl, Postman Sep 25, 2024 · IIS CORS module simplifies the configuration process for the server administrator. NET Core app. Have a look the configuration reference for more information. In this article, I am going to discuss how to enable CORS or Cross-Origin Resource Sharing in Web API which allows cross-domain AJAX calls. js, Flask, and Spring Boot, and avoid common cross-origin request errors. config and has it’s own cors configuration section within system. To enable CORS in your Node. Postman desktop agent If you are using the Postman web client, you will need to also download the Postman desktop agent to overcome the Cross-Origin Resource Sharing (CORS) limitations of browsers. js allows us to add CORS to our application and enable all CORS requests. js project, developers need to install it via npm. 1 with MIT licence at our NPM packages aggregator and search engine. Improve your Django and Git skills with my books. CORS Enabled What is CORS about? CORS is a specification that enables truly open access across domain boundaries. Cross-Origin Resource Sharing (CORS) is an HTTP-header based mechanism that allows a server to indicate any origins (domain, scheme, or port) other than its own from which a browser should permit loading resources. Installation Usage Simple Usage Configuring CORS Configuring CORS Asynchronously Enabling CORS Pre-Flight Enabling CORS Application-wide Configuration Options License Author Installation (via npm) $ npm install cors Node. Simply activate the add-on and perform the request. 5, IIS 10 Overview The Microsoft IIS CORS Module is an extension that enables web sites to support the CORS (Cross-Origin Resource Sharing) protocol. , JavaScript) are prevented from accessing much of the Web of Linked Data due to "same origin" restrictions implemented in all major Web browsers. Why is CORS Important? Without CORS, a malicious website could make API calls on behalf of a user and steal their sensitive data (e. The good news is that resolving those errors is as simple as enabling CORS. Installation is done using the npm install Elysia is an ergonomic framework for Humans. You can then configure it, and enable it with the command app. Here's a simple example of how to enable CORS for all requests in an Express-based application: Jul 16, 2025 · Cross-Origin Resource Sharing (CORS) is essential for modern web apps. As a developer, you might encounter a situation where a client request to the server fails, and the browser displays a red error like "CORS policy A step-by-step tutorial for developers on how to effectively integrate Cursor into a full-stack application, with tips for maximizing its capabilities while minimizing disruption. js module available through the npm registry. The IIS CORS module helps with setting appropriate response headers and responding to preflight requests. It controls which domains can access your server resources. 5, IIS 8, IIS 8. webserver. This might be useful if you need different CORS configurations for different application resources. npm install axios Step 3: Make a CORS Request To send an authenticated request and handle CORS, you need to include the Access-Control-Allow-Credentials header to ensure that the browser allows the server to share resources. -- It is important to note that this extension fixes preflight requests to permit access to any custom header (when enabled). g. Run the proper command to install CORS module to IIS Express, If the CORS module for IIS has been installed on this same machine in advance, then -msiFile switch can be This article guides Linux developers on enabling CORS (Cross-Origin Resource Sharing) on their servers using Bash scripting. There are 27177 other projects in the npm registry using cors. 5, last published: 6 years ago. Let’s walk through setting up CORS on an existing Express server. Install a browser extension: Several browser extensions allow you to disable CORS, such as “Allow CORS: Access-Control-Allow-Origin” for Google Chrome and “CORS Everywhere” for Firefox. Adds CORS (Cross-Origin Resource Sharing) headers support in your Laravel application - fruitcake/laravel-cors What Is CORS? CORS is a security feature. The cors module simplifies CORS configuration. js. enable cross-origin resource sharing Cross-Origin Resource Sharing (CORS) is a specification that enables cross-domain resource access in a secure and standardized way. How to Implement Cross-Origin Resource Sharing (CORS) CORS is a Node. js package for providing a connect / express middleware that can be used to enable CORS with various options. config file, as explained here: IIS CORS module Configuration Reference I recently used this to Reverse Proxy to a REST API and handling the CORS only in IIS so that I don't have to rebuild my project to change CORS settings. js package that provides a Connect/Express middleware that you can. json file. This allows in-browser requests to your Django application from other origins. Adding CORS headers allows your resources to be accessed on other domains. Install CORS The CORS middleware is just like any other package, and can be installed with NPM or yarn. , making requests to a banking API from an unauthorized site). c> Header set Access-Control-Allow-Origin "*" </IfModule> Method 2 Understanding CORS and Why It Matters CORS (Cross-Origin Resource Sharing) is a security feature implemented by web browsers that restricts web applications from making requests to a different domain than the one that served the web page. Still I'm getting the above error. Cross-origin resource sharing (CORS) is a mechanism for integrating applications. This article provides an overview of the IIS CORS module and explains the configuration of the module. They can do so by running the following command in the terminal: npm install cors Basic Usage To use the cors module, you need to import it and apply it to your Express application. js code, including using the cors package, setting the necessary headers manually, and using the http-proxy-middleware In this article, you’ll learn about an important concept: Cross-Origin Resource Sharing (CORS) policy. These headers tell browsers which origins can read responses from your server. By default, browsers block cross-origin requests for security. 0 - a TypeScript package on npm The cors npm package simplifies CORS configuration in Node. config file. In this article, we will learn to install Flask-CORS which is a Python module and a Flask extension that supports and allows cross-origin resource sharing (CORS) through a simple decorator. django-cors-headers is a Django application for handling the server headers required for Cross-Origin Resource Sharing (CORS). Running a MERN project in VS Code is simple once you understand the workflow. cd my-api-app Step 2: Install Axios To use Axios in your React application, you need to install it first. Elysia has got you covered, start building next generation TypeScript web servers today. Elysia is familiar, fast, and has first-class TypeScript support with well-thought integration between services whether it's tRPC, Swagger or WebSocket. 8. The below steps will guide you how to download and install the IIS CORS module and configure it by updating web. I want to add CORS support to my server There are some more headers and settings involved if you want to support verbs other than GET/POST, custom headers, or authentication. debugger" to overwrite 4xx status codes (in case a server does not support a method, you can use this feature to pretend the server accepts a response or supports an unsupported method). config support for custom headers, no modules/extensions for CORS. CORS is a Node. It's easy to use (Enable All CORS Requests) Adding the following snippet to app. Node. csproj file directly in the site. Contribute to expressjs/cors development by creating an account on GitHub. The extension also optionally fixes CORS policies of redirected URLs. It's important CORS cannot be fixed on the client side except in the case that the server will modify its response and add the necessary response headers based on a change to the request which is made to it. Jun 15, 2025 · Learn what CORS is, how to configure it in Node. Fix cross-origin issues and make your APIs work smoothly. We found that tauri-plugin-cors-fetch demonstrated a healthy version release cadence and project activity because the last version was released less than a year ago. js code, including using the cors package, setting the necessary headers manually, and using the http-proxy-middleware Le « Cross-origin resource sharing » (CORS) ou « partage des ressources entre origines multiples » (en français, moins usité) est un mécanisme qui consiste à ajouter des en-têtes HTTP afin de permettre à un agent utilisateur d'accéder à des ressources d'un serveur situé sur une autre origine que le site courant. Latest version: 2. use(cors()) and also with cors options as below. Installing this add-on will allow you to unblock this feature. No Wildcard Alternatives: Cannot implement secure multi-origin CORS through configuration alone. CORS is a mechanism to let a user-agent access resources from a domain outside of the domain from which A lightweight CORS proxy for local development, powered by Bun - 1. 0. GitHub Gist: instantly share code, notes, and snippets. CORS or Cross-Origin Resource Sharing is blocked in modern browsers by default (in JavaScript APIs). Start using cors in your project by running `npm i cors`. Master express CORS handling with our comprehensive guide on NPM cors() package. To do so, you must install the CORS Module in IIS and add some configuration in the web. Download Microsoft CORS Module for IIS installer. Learn how CORS as a standard for allowing or rejecting cross-origin requests in an ASP. js middleware for Express / Connect that sets CORS response headers. Enable CORS for a Single Route Configuring CORS Configuring CORS w/ Dynamic Origin Enabling CORS Pre-Flight Customizing CORS Settings Dynamically per Request Configuration Options Common Misconceptions License Original Author Installation This is a Node. By organizing your folders, managing dependencies, and using VS Code’s powerful extensions, you can streamline your full-stack development process. CORS defines a way for client web applications that are loaded in one domain to interact with resources in a different domain. Method 1: Simple Configuration (Least Secure) To add CORS authorization to all responses, add the following inside either the <Directory>, <Location>, <Files> or <VirtualHost> sections of your server config (usually located in a *. js Install CORS module in IIS 10 The Microsoft IIS CORS Module is an extension that enables web sites to support the CORS (Cross-Origin Resource Sharing) protocol. js server-side applications using TypeScript and combining OOP, FP, and FRP principles. 1 package - Last release 0. Once installed, the IIS CORS module is configured via a site or application web. Node app. Let's break it down into two essential aspects: installation and debugging! 🛠️ 6. Check @zcorky/koa-cors 0. js apps often need CORS to work with front-end frameworks like React or Angular. js CORS middleware. CORS, or Cross-Origin Resource Sharing, is a vital topic for web developers dealing with cross-origin requests. Use this page to learn how to set a CORS configuration on a Cloud Storage bucket and how to view the CORS configuration set on a bucket. 7. use(cors()). cors CORS is a node. The CORS plugin can also be installed to specific routes. Install lessmsi tool and configure it in your PATH (so that lessmsi can be called by the install script). conf file, such as httpd. I have tried with app. CORS also relies on a mechanism by which browsers make a "preflight" request to the server hosting the cross-origin resource, in order to check that the server will permit the Jul 23, 2025 · To use cors in a Node. The IIS CORS Module enables support for the Cross-Origin Resource Sharing (CORS) protocol. Install IIS Express. Learn installation, usage, and explore examples. If you can't use extension bundles and are only able to work in the portal, you need to use Advanced Tools (Kudu) to manually create the extensions. Overview Configuration samples Cross Origin Resource Sharing (CORS) allows interactions between resources from different origins, something that is normally prohibited in order to prevent malicious behavior. CORS allows you to specify which origins can access your resources, from a single trusted domain to multiple domains, or even public access for truly open content like CDN assets. CORS is enforced by browsers: they check the headers and decide if JavaScript can read the response. And thankfully, the setup is quite minimal thanks to the cors middleware. It allows servers to handle requests from different origins. CORS (Cross-Origin Resource Sharing) CORS or "Cross-Origin Resource Sharing" refers to the situations when a frontend running in a browser has JavaScript code that communicates with a backend, and the backend is in a different "origin" than the frontend. htaccess file: <IfModule mod_headers. js applications, allowing developers to define custom CORS policies and manage cross-origin resource sharing effectively. Install CORS module in IIS 10 The Microsoft IIS CORS Module is an extension that enables web sites to support the CORS (Cross-Origin Resource Sharing) protocol. In this article, we’ll discuss three methods to include CORS in your Node. conf or apache. Limited Configuration: No web. IIS CORS Module Works With: IIS 7. use to enable CORS with a variety of parameters. Express CORS middleware plays a crucial role in facilitating Cross-Origin Resource Sharing (CORS) in applications built using the… NestJS is a framework for building efficient, scalable Node. [!IMPORTANT] How CORS Works: This package sets response headers—it doesn't block requests. Without CORS, browsers block requests from different origins. Servers use CORS headers to allow or restrict access. If you install the CORS plugin to a specific route, you need to add the options handler to this route. It details CORS configuration steps for Apache and Nginx, including editing server files and adding necessary headers. Description Allow CORS: Access-Control-Allow-Origin lets you easily perform cross-domain Ajax requests in web applications. Additionally, it covers testing CORS settings with tools like curl and automating configurations through Bash scripts, ensuring smooth functionality for . It has 1 open source maintainer collaborating on the project. ztjht, mfhs0r, s73x, c6cx9, ndj0od, pberh, m0qy, frtro, loha, 7m4zc,